.ctools-locked {
    padding: 1em;
    border: 1px solid red;
    border-image: none;
    color: red;
}

.ctools-owns-lock {
    background: 0px 0px rgb(255, 255, 221);
    padding: 1em;
    border: 1px solid rgb(240, 192, 32);
    border-image: none;
}

a.ctools-ajaxing {
    background: url("../images/status-active.gif") no-repeat right;
    padding-right: 18px !important;
}

input.ctools-ajaxing {
    background: url("../images/status-active.gif") no-repeat right;
    padding-right: 18px !important;
}

button.ctools-ajaxing {
    background: url("../images/status-active.gif") no-repeat right;
    padding-right: 18px !important;
}

select.ctools-ajaxing {
    background: url("../images/status-active.gif") no-repeat right;
    padding-right: 18px !important;
}

div.ctools-ajaxing {
    background: url("../images/status-active.gif") no-repeat center;
    width: 18px;
    float: left;
}
